Mastering the Timing: A Guide to Safe Passage
Successfully navigating your chicken across the road isn't simply about frantic button mashing; it demands a careful assessment of traffic patterns and precise timing. The key is to observe the speed and spacing of oncoming vehicles, identifying gaps large enough to safely traverse. Experienced players will learn to anticipate the movements of cars, trucks, and other obstacles, even predicting their trajectories based on their current velocity. However, don’t underestimate the unexpected! The introduction of varying vehicle speeds, coupled with the occasional unpredictable event – a speeding motorcycle, a suddenly appearing tractor – keeps players on their toes and prevents the gameplay from becoming monotonous. Developing a rhythm, a sense of when to go and when to wait, is crucial for survival. Practicing consistent, deliberate movements will drastically improve your success rate.
Understanding Obstacle Variety and Patterns
The types of obstacles you'll encounter aren't limited to four-wheeled vehicles. Many versions of the game introduce a diverse range of hazards, each requiring a slightly different approach. Expect to see buses, lorries, and even bicycles adding to the complexity. Furthermore, the patterns in which these obstacles appear are rarely completely random. While there’s an element of chance, observing the game will reveal subtle cues and repeating sequences. Learning to recognize these patterns allows players to predict oncoming threats and plan their crossings accordingly. Pay attention to the intervals between vehicles; are they consistently spaced, or do they come in bursts? Understanding these nuances is the difference between a quick demise and a continued climb up the leaderboard.
| Obstacle Type | Speed | Behavior | Strategic Response |
|---|---|---|---|
| Car | Moderate | Consistent, predictable | Standard timing, watch for gaps. |
| Truck | Slow | Large, blocks vision | Use as a temporary shield, but be mindful of stopping distance. |
| Motorcycle | Fast | Unpredictable | Requires quick reflexes and careful observation. |
| Bus | Slow to Moderate | Large, frequent | Requires patience and identifying consistent gaps. |
The table above illustrates the different obstacle types, their typical speeds, how they behave and what the response should be for a more strategic play. Mastering each type will bring you closer to success.

Strategies for Optimizing Your Gameplay
While luck undoubtedly plays a role, there are several strategies players can employ to significantly improve their chances of survival. One effective technique is to focus on the gaps between vehicles rather than attempting to time your crossing around individual cars. This allows for more margin for error and reduces the risk of miscalculation. Another useful tactic is to observe the road for a few seconds before making a move, carefully studying the traffic patterns and anticipating potential hazards. Don’t rush into a crossing; patience is often rewarded. Utilizing the brief moments when traffic slows down or stops can provide a safe opportunity to make your move. Furthermore, mastering the game’s controls and optimizing your reaction time is crucial for success.
